ETI Corral 20 By-laws
Equestrian Trails, Inc.
Corral #20 - Shadow Hills, CA
By-Laws
Article I
Section I: The name of Corral #20 - Equestrian Trails, Inc. shall be: Shadow Hills Roughriders Corral 20.
Article II
Section I: These By-laws do not supersede the By-laws now in effect for Equestrian Trails, Inc., the parent organization.
Article III
Section I: The purpose of the Corral is hereby set forth:
- Preservation and acquisition of riding and hiking trails.
- Promotion of better horsemanship.
- Support legislation that will benefit equestrians in general.
- Sponsor dances, horseshows, playdays, trail rides and any other suitable activities.
Article IV
Dues
Section I: Dues shall be in accordance to structure outlined by Equestrian Trails, Inc.
Section II: Members in good standing shall be entitled to all the privileges and benefits of this Corral as set forth in these By-laws.
Section III: Any member may be dismissed for misconduct or abuse of horses. The accused must receive a written notice stating in detail the charges against him, and be given the right to be heard before the Board of Directors, with Counsel if necessary, before any action to dismiss is taken.
Article V
Corral Meetings
Section I: There shall be one General Meeting each month of the year. Date, time, and place of meeting to be approved by the membership. Cancellation of General Meeting will be left to the discretion of the Board. Board of Director and Special meetings may be called at the discretion of the President.
Section II: A quorum of 10 Senior Members shall be necessary to conduct a regular General business meeting of the Corral.
- Senior Members are those members 18 years of age and over.
- Junior Members are those members under 18 years of age.
Section III: A quorum for a board meeting shall be a majority of the Board.
Article VI
Officers
Section I: The officers of this Corral shall be: President, Vice President, Secretary and Treasurer. Officers shall be elected by the vote of the membership.
Section II: The President, Vice President, Area Delegate and Alternate Area Delegate, elected by the membership, may represent this Corral at the meetings of the parent organization.
Section III: All Officers must be a member in good standing.
Article VII
Duties of Officers
Section I: The President shall be the Chief Executive Officer of this Corral and shall have general supervision, direction and control of the business and the officers of this Corral. The President shall sign all papers, contracts and documents required by the corral that are proper and necessary to carry on the business of the Corral. All powers and duties imposed by these By-laws shall be exercised by the President. He shall preside at all General and Board meetings.
Section II: In the absence or inability of the President to act, the Vice President is vested with all powers and shall perform all the duties of the President. The Vice President shall act as a host to all visiting dignitaries and guests.
Section III: Secretary - It shall be the duty of the Secretary to attend all meetings, record all votes and keep a permanent record of all minutes. If unable to attend any meeting it is the responsibility of the Secretary to notify the President and provide a suitable alternate. Archives of all minutes and correspondences shall be passed on to their successor.
Section IV: Treasurer - It shall be the duty of the Treasurer to receive all moneys belonging to the Corral. The Treasurer shall retain all checks and warrants, keep an account of receipts and expenditures and provide monthly reports at the General meeting. The Treasurer shall pay over and deliver all moneys, books and records to his successor.
Article VIII
Elections
Section I: Nominations shall be made in September and October and closed at the October monthly meeting. The membership shall be notified in writing of all nominations prior to November election. Consent of each nominee shall be obtained prior to nomination. Elections shall take place during the month of November. All voting members must be present. Newly elected officers will take office January 1st and serve through December 31st.
Section II: Any member of the Board being absent three consecutive General or Board meetings without just cause as determined by the Board of Directors may have his office declared vacant.
Section III: A vacancy in an elective office shall be filled by Presidential appointment with approval of the Board of Directors.
Section IV: No member shall hold more than one elective office at the same time.
Section V: Voting age of Corral membership shall be 18 years.
Section VI: Nominees for elected positions shall be members in good standing.
Article IX
Appointments
Section I: Upon taking office the President may appoint the following: Scribe, Historian, Newsletter, Marshall, Audit Committee, Corresponding Secretary, Membership Chairperson, and any other chairperson deemed necessary.
Section II: Marshall - It shall be the duty of the Marshall to have direct custody of all Corral property and to be responsible for the preservation and care of same. He shall maintain law and order in all Corral meetings and activities.
Section III: Audit Committee - It shall be the duty of the Audit committee to audit the books quarterly and report thereon at the next regular meeting of the Corral.
Section IV: Membership Chairperson - It shall be the duty of the membership chairperson to have charge of all matters pertaining to membership of the Corral, including to procuring of new members, and the reinstatement and eligibility of members.
Section V: Corresponding Secretary - It shall be the duty of the Corresponding Secretary to handle all Corral correspondence.
Article X
Administration
Section I: The administration of the Corral shall be entrusted to a Board of Directors, their decisions being subject to approval by the membership.
Section II: The Board of Directors shall consist of 14 members - President, Vice President, Immediate Past President, Secretary, Treasurer, Area Delegate, Alternate Area Delegate, Trail Coordinator, Event Coordinator, Clinic/Lecturer Coordinator, Junior Coordinator and three elected Board Members.
Section III: The Area Delegate: It shall be the duty of the Area Delegate to attend all Area 7 meetings and represent the Corral at such meetings. The Area Delegate shall provide reports at the Corral's General meetings. The Area Delegate may represent the Corral at meetings of the parent organization and local organizations.
Section IV: Alternate Delegate - It shall be the duty of the Alternate Area Delegate to assume all of the above duties in the absence of the Area Delegate.
Section V: Trial Coordinator - It shall be the duty of the Trial Coordinator to supervise the scheduling and planning of all Corral rides and assist the Trail Boss of such rides as needed. The Trail Coordinator shall ensure that the trail boss for each ride submits all ads, articles and reports. The Trail Coordinator shall retain all signed insurance liabilities waivers.
Section VI: Event Coordinator - It shall be the duty of the Event Coordinator to supervise the scheduling and planning of all Corral events and fund-raisers, such as Harvest Moon dance, playdays, trails trials, etc., and assist the chairperson of such events as needed. The Event Coordinator shall retain all signed insurance waivers from such events.
Section VII: Clinic/Guest Speaker Coordinator - It shall be the duty of the Clinic/Guest Speaker Coordinator to supervise the scheduling and planning of all clinics and guest speaker sponsored by the Corral and to assist the person in charge of such activities as needed.
Section VIII: Junior Coordinator - It shall be the duty of the Junior Coordinator to plan and supervise all the activities of the Junior members of the Corral.
Section IX: The Board of Directors shall transact all necessary business between meetings and such other business as may be referred by the members.
Section X: As needed the Board may conduct a vote by direct contact, telephone or E-Mail. A reasonable effort must be made to contact each and every Board member. Documentation of motion and results must be submitted to Secretary and recorded.
Article XI
Limitations and Liabilities
Section I: Under no circumstance shall any Corral officer, member of any committee or member of this Corral contract or incur any obligation for this Corral without first having secured written authorization from the Board of Directors.
Section II: Discretionary Funds - The President and the Chairperson of Corral events are entitled to use up to a specified amount of Corral funds for Corral business at there own discretion without prior approval.
- The President's limits are set at $50.00 per purchase with a maximum of $150.00 per year.
- The event limits are set at $50.00 for small events and $100.00 for large events.
- The set amounts can be increased by Board approval.
Section III: This Corral shall not incur or cause to be incurred any obligation that might subject to liability any other Corral, subdivision, group or member of Equestrian Trails, Inc., other individuals, corporations or organizations.
Article XII
Activity Limitations
Section I: Abuse of alcohol or drugs shall not be tolerated at any Corral activities.
Article XIII
Amendments
Section I: These By-laws may be amended at any regular Corral meeting by a vote of two-thirds of the members present and voting, provided that the proposed amendment(s) shall have been submitted in writing and read at the previous regular meeting and provided that written notice shall have been given to all members at least ten (10) days in advance of the date when such amendment(s) is to be voted on.
Article XIV
Rules of Order
Section I: Robert's Rules of Order shall govern the conduct of all meetings, except as may be provided in these By-laws.
